
Nairobi
Nairobi is the capital and largest city of Kenya, known for its vibrant culture, diverse population, and significant role as a commercial and financial hub in East Africa. The city is home to numerous international organizations, including the United Nations Environment Programme, and is recognized for its unique blend of urban life and wildlife, exemplified by the Nairobi National Park located just outside the city center.
